Olympics-Athletics-Six leading Russian women to miss Games

MOSCOW, July 31 (Reuters) - The International Association of Athletics Federations (IAAF) has banned six leading Russian women after they were suspected of manipulating drug samples, a senior official said on Thursday.

"All six are definitely suspended and will miss the Beijing Olympics," Russia's athletics chief Valentin Balakhnichyov told Reuters.

The six are: twice world 1,500 metres champion Tatyana Tomashova, world indoor 1,500 metres champion Yelena Soboleva, distance runners Yuliya Fomenko and Svetlana Cherkasova, European discus champion Darya Pishchalnikova and former hammer world record holder Gulfia Khanafeyeva.

The Olympics start on Aug. 8.
